You have only one opportunity to program each of the hero's moves. Will you be able to let the hero escape?

Team members
We're sha-bits, a team from Belgium and France made of Hadopire, Shatzy and Aureoreo! Credits to petricakegames for the art that we tweaked a bit!

Software used
Godot 4.0.1, Aseprite, Ableton Live

Use of the limitation
The hero is an empty shell that simply receives commands ; you play as the programmer behind it!
